Difference Between Euglena and Paramecium

The main difference between Euglena and Paramecium is that Euglena can be either animal-like or plant-like organisms whereas Paramecium is an animal-like organism. Only Euglena consists of chloroplasts. Paramecium does not contain its own chloroplasts. ... Euglena uses flagella for locomotion while Paramecium uses cilia.

What is the difference between amoeba and paramecium?

Amoeba is a unicellular protozoan which moves by temporary projections called pseudopodia whereas paramecium is a single-celled freshwater animal with a characteristic slipper-like shape. ... Amoeba moves by forming pseudopodia whereas paramecium moves by beating the cilia.

How are amoeba paramecium and euglena similar?

All three protists had a nucleus, as expected, but the Paramecium had two nuclei, a micronucleus and a macronucleus. The Paramecium and Amoeba both had food and contractile vacuoles, but these were lacking in the Euglena. ... Of the three, Euglena was the only one that had chloroplasts, an organelle common in plants.

How do paramecium and euglena move differently?

Paramecium move with cilia, so they are called ciliates. Euglena: a genus of diverse unicellular organisms, some of which have both animal and plant characteristics. (They eat food the way animals do, and can photosynthesize, like plants.) Euglena move with a single flagellum, so they are called flagellates.

Which is faster amoeba or paramecium?

A paramecium can move faster than an amoeba because of the methods of their locomotion.

What are the similarities between Amoeba and euglena?

Both of them are unicellular eucaryotic organisms. They are also both capable of moving and reproducing. They both “eat” by using phagocytosis. Euglena is more similar to amoebas than other protists because its cellular membrane isn't as firm as with the others.

Is euglena unicellular or multicellular?

Euglena are unicellular organisms classified into the Kingdom Protista, and the Phylum Euglenophyta. All euglena have chloroplasts and can make their own food by photosynthesis.

Why are euglena and paramecium both eukaryotes?

Amoebas, paramecia, and euglena are all considered eukaryotic cells because they contain membrane-bound organelles which include a defined nucleus....

How does a euglena move?

All euglena have chloroplasts and can make their own food by photosynthesis. ... Euglena move by a flagellum (plural ‚ flagella), which is a long whip-like structure that acts like a little motor. The flagellum is located on the anterior (front) end, and twirls in such a way as to pull the cell through the water.

How does the eyespot benefit the euglena?

Euglena also have an eyespot at the anterior end that detects light, it can be seen near the reservoir. This helps the euglena find bright areas to gather sunlight to make their food.
